To be honest, I'm not sure anything like that exists. There are a lot of books, tutorials and so forth that will teach you how to use the tools - like the one you have just read - but putting those tools to use requires aptitude, ability, skill, and experience - and I'm not convinced that any of those can be taught.
What you are asking is the equivalent of learning to use a paint brush to do water colours, and looking for a book on how to paint the Mona Lisa, or Constables "The Hay Wain"
There are tutorials and suchlike on Google[^] - but how much use they will be is entirely open to debate. If I'm honest, most good developers are rubbish graphics designers!
If you do find a book or tutorial that does teach you to do it well, please post it here - there are a lot of people here who need to read it (including me).
